The York University Lions women's basketball team was led this season by their powerhouse guard,
Kiara Leveridge. The conference announced the OUA all-star selections on Wednesday, and among it was Leveridge.
Kiara Leveridge, a third-year social work major, was selected as an OUA second-team all-star. Leveridge finished the regular season leading the OUA in free-throws (161-205), and led the league in points per 40 minutes (28.4). She was second in the OUA in points (458) and points per game (20.8), while finishing in fourth for field goals (135-390), and fifth in offensive rebounds (71).
Playing in 645 minutes of conference action, she led her team in free throw percentage (78.5), steals (45) and total rebounds (159; 71 offensive, 88 defensive), while starting and playing in all 22 games this season.Â
This is Leveridge's second OUA all-star selection, after being selected to the OUA all-rookie team in the 2021-22, while also earning OUA rookie of the year honours.Â
